How to Calculate Mean, Standard Deviation (SD), Standard Error of the Mean (SEM), and 95% Confidence Interval for a Sample of Values 1. Sample MeanA sample is a collection of measurements or values. The sample mean is the average value in a sample. It is calculated using the following equation: = !!To calculate the sample mean: 1. Sum all the values (x) in a given Divide the sum by the number (n) of values in the sample.
